vložil Radek Červinka
28. února 2011 21:29
Tak jo, zde jsou výsledky. Když jsem tuto optimalizační soutěž navrhoval, tipoval jsem limit tak kolem 100ms. Navrhoval jsem úlohu, která je dostatečně rychlá na základní naprogramování, má potenciál na optimalizaci a která by se dala celkem jednoduše paralelně zpracovávat. Výsledek mne opravdu překvapil.Více...
vložil Radek Červinka
24. února 2011 21:45
Rád bych ještě jednu anketu - vyprovokoval mne k ní thread na non-technical. Co tedy používáte za program pro správu verzí Vašich kódů? (Osobně už x let JVCS, ale asi přejdeme na SVN k vůli funkcím nikoliv stabilitě).
A pár odkazů ohledně VCS:
Pokud znáte nějaké další rozšíření IDE tak můžete použít komentářů.
BTW: Výsledky anket
vložil Radek Červinka
22. února 2011 22:36
Když jsem v psaní o té grafice tak nemůžu zapomenout na GDI+ pro Delphi. API konverzi je dostupná na progdigy.com zároveň spolu s cca 80 kousky kódu jako ukázka.
Více...
vložil Radek Červinka
19. února 2011 23:10
O Graphics32 (nebo jednoduše GR32) jsem už psal. Jedná se o brutálně rychlou knihovnu pro práci s grafikou. A nad ní (stejně jako nad jiným kvalitním základem) se dá stavět. A jednou z těchto nadstaveb je GR32_Lines (a potažmo GR32_Text ze stejného balíku), autorem je Angus Johnson.
Více...
vložil Radek Červinka
16. února 2011 23:36
Udělal jsem chybu s tím průběžným zveřejňováním výsledků. Teď mi nechodí žádné pomalejší řešení.
Prosím, mohl by někdo poslat i nějaké takové řešení, které nemusí být první? Zatím každý algoritmus co dorazil byl jiný. Třeba budete mít taky nějaký zvláštní. Ať je to pestré.
Update: podle návrhu udělím i cenu za nejoriginálnější řešení - i když nebude nejrychlejší - něco jako minule cena poroty.
650c8af1-dd4b-405a-86c9-cf74cdd70d19|0|.0
Tagy:
soutez
vložil Radek Červinka
15. února 2011 22:22
Jelikož další verze Delphi s opravdu velkou pravděpodobností bude podporovat 64bit, začínají se objevovat zajímavé informace a jelikož tato mi přišla opravdu velmi zajímavá, tak ji sprostě šlohnu a ani ji nebudu překládat. Autorem komentáře je Allen Bauer - Embarcadero Chief Scientist. Více...
vložil Radek Červinka
13. února 2011 21:26
Nedávno šel v konferenci problém ohledně různého DPI (nebo velikosti písma) při navrhování programu a za běhu. Sice jsem přispěl řešením, ale jelikož se jedná o jednoduché řešení, je škoda kdyby zapadlo.
Například následující okno:
Více...
vložil Radek Červinka
7. února 2011 22:15
Aktualizace:
- update: výsledky
- update6: Tomáš Kořínek
- update5: J. Jelínek a jeho třetí pokus.
- update4: aktualizace pořadí, změna na možnost 3 řešení, průběžné výsledky jsou zpět
- update3: podle návrhu udělím i cenu za nejoriginálnější řešení - i když nebude nejrychlejší - něco jako minule cena poroty. Jako podporu pro zasílání i krapet pomalejších řešení.
- update2: další soutěžící
- update: vylepšené měření, můj druhý pokus, dva další soutěžící
Od minulé soutěže mi už otrnulo a jelikož převážná většina lidí v anketě nebyla proti dalšímu kolu soutěže a do jara ještě chvilku máme čas, je zde další úkol.
Proti minulému kolu jsem změnil několik pravidel:
- je možno použít libovolný kompilátor pascalu (Delphi 2 - Delphi XE, FreePascal, ohledně C++Builderu zatím nevím zda by byl zájem)
- testované budou výsledné Vámi přeložené aplikace (minule jen jedna obsahující všechny řešení), zdrojový kód je jen pro kontrolu vítězů
- průběžně budou zveřejňovány přeložené aplikace, zaslané zdrojové kódy budou zveřejněny nakonec
Více...
vložil Radek Červinka
6. února 2011 23:39
Neuvěřitelné (a můj tajný sen). Je vidět, že někdo v EMBT opravdu má hlavu na přemýšlení. KSDEV, resp. Eugene A. Kryukov (včetně intelektuálního vlastnictví) se stává součástí firmy Embarcadero. Podle mne jedna z nejdůležitějších a nejinteligentnějších akvizicí co se mohla stát.
Více...
vložil Radek Červinka
5. února 2011 21:54
Jelikož Starter edice neobsahuje command line kompilátor - který je často využíván při instalaci velkých balíků komponent - byla připravena binární varianta JCL a JVCL.
JCL: cc.embarcadero.com/Item/28222
JVCL: cc.embarcadero.com/Item/28223
Podle mne bude balík fungovat i pro ostatní varianty XE, takže pokud se nechcete zdržovat kompilací máte možnost.
vložil Radek Červinka
3. února 2011 23:36
Je to časté téma. Takže vpravo je nová anketa - věk programátora v Delphi. Nebo můžete použít link blueboard.cz/hlasovat-k2n8.
addf7f30-210d-488d-a1de-8a8add89c15b|1|5.0
Tagy: server
Server
vložil Radek Červinka
2. února 2011 22:40
Dostávám relativně často žádost o pomoc - a hodně často i pomůžu, zvláště pokud se jedná o zajímavý problém (nebo i z jiných důvodů).
Nedávno se mi ozval člověk, který spravuje komunitní stránky kolem jednoho staršího programu napsaného v Delphi 5. Program je celkem speciální a také unikátní, takže časem se rozšířil po světě mezi uživateli v astro komunitě. Více...
vložil Radek Červinka
2. února 2011 22:33
Ješte k Delphi XE Starter: kniha Delphi XE Starter Essentials je nyní zdarma při zakoupení Starter edice. Po zakoupení a registraci stáhněte zde.